How Tunnel Car Washes Work: The Assembly Line Approach

Tunnel car washes operate like an automotive assembly line. Vehicles move on a conveyor belt through an elongated tunnel where specialized equipment performs sequential cleaning steps – from initial rinsing and soap application to waxing and final drying. This highly automated process delivers remarkable speed and efficiency without requiring drivers to exit their vehicles.

While requiring more space than conventional car washes, tunnel systems compensate with significantly higher throughput capacity. This makes them particularly suitable for high-demand urban environments where volume processing is essential.

Key Advantages Driving Popularity

Among various car wash business models, tunnel systems stand out through several compelling benefits:

  • Consistent Cleaning Quality: Well-maintained tunnel systems deliver uniform results with each wash cycle, helping build customer trust and loyalty through reliable service quality.
  • High-Volume Processing: With approximately 36% of vehicle owners washing their cars weekly, tunnel systems' ability to handle hundreds of cars daily provides significant revenue potential compared to manual alternatives.
  • Reduced Labor Requirements: The automated nature minimizes staffing needs while maximizing service capacity, creating operational efficiencies that translate to stronger profitability.
System Variations: Choosing the Right Configuration

Tunnel car washes come in several configurations to suit different business needs:

  • Fully Automated Systems: The most common type uses conveyor belts to move vehicles through the tunnel where rotating brushes or soft cloth materials clean all exterior surfaces within minutes.
  • Touchless Systems: These eliminate physical contact with vehicles, relying instead on high-pressure water jets and specialized cleaning agents to remove dirt, followed by air drying.
  • Hybrid Models: Some operators combine tunnel washing with self-service stations, allowing customers to receive automated exterior cleaning before performing interior detailing themselves.
  • Full-Service Options: Premium configurations offer comprehensive interior and exterior cleaning services beyond basic tunnel washing.
